PENGARUH SERVICE QUALITY, DELIVERY SPEED DAN BRAND IMAGE TERHADAP REPURCHASE INTENTION MELALUI CUSTOMER SATISFACTION SEBAGAI VARIABEL INTERVENING PADA PENGGUNA LAYANAN DELIVERY OJEK ONLINE JOKI SITUBONDO
Abstract
The increasingly competitive service industry requires businesses to continuously improve service quality, delivery speed, and brand image to enhance customer satisfaction and encourage repurchase intention. This study aims to analyze and examine the effects of service quality, delivery speed, and brand image on repurchase intention, with customer satisfaction serving as an intervening variable, among users of Joki Situbondo delivery services. This research employed an explanatory research design. The population comprised customers who had previously used Joki Situbondo services. A purposive sampling technique was applied, yielding a sample of 114 respondents. Data analysis and hypothesis testing were conducted using the Structural Equation Modeling–Partial Least Squares (PLS-SEM) approach with SmartPLS 3.0 software. The results of the direct effect analysis reveal that service quality has a significant positive effect on customer satisfaction, but no significant effect on repurchase intention. Meanwhile, delivery speed has no significant effect on either customer satisfaction or repurchase intention. Furthermore, brand image has a significant positive effect on both customer satisfaction and repurchase intention, while customer satisfaction significantly and positively influences repurchase intention. The indirect effect analysis indicates that service quality significantly influences repurchase intention through customer satisfaction. In contrast, the indirect effects of delivery speed and brand image on repurchase intention through customer satisfaction are not statistically significant.
